The distinct, emblematic and chic label of Lamda Assyrtiko Barrique 2018 from Ktima (domaine) Ligas, with Maria Callas on it, is in perfect harmony with the complex and impressive content of the bottle. The symbolism behind this choice is that as Callas lived and excelled abroad, Assyrtiko is also making a brilliant international career.
Behind this wine lies the unstoppable and inventive Jason Ligas. Jason constantly experiments with new techniques based on mild natural vinification. His philosophy is summarized in the following: permaculture*, no interventions in wine, no sulphites or commercial yeast added. Lamda Assyrtiko Barrique 2018 is an Assyrtiko that ferments with indigenous yeasts and matures in old, large, oak barrels for 8-12 months. It is bottled unfiltered and the result is exuberant, velvety but also elegant as it was the voice of Maria Callas.

*Permaculture takes its name from permanent agriculture and concerns a way of cultivation that ensures a life cycle. In simple terms, the cultivation of the vine does not compete with nature but works with her for the purpose of sustainability and viability of the environment.
